It is conceivable that the initial update file you download is corrupted and will not install. You must delete the corrupted update file in this scenario. Download the update file again after the broken file has been totally deleted. Here's how it works: \

1. Go to your iPhone's Settings.
2. Select General.
3. Select iPhone Storage.
4. In the list of apps, look for the iOS update file.
5. Select the iOS update.
6. Select Delete Update.
7. After deleting the file, navigate to the Settings-> General-> Software Update menu.
8. Then, get the most recent iOS update.
9. check if it works or not
